Ed, I use following query modified based on metalink note 861595.1 to add few columns for thread#: select arch.thread# "Thread", appl.first_time "LastSeqApp1sttime",appl.sequence# "Last Sequence Applied", arch.first_time "LastSeqRec1sttime",arch.sequence# "Last Sequence Received", (arch.sequence# - appl.sequence#) "DiffSeq", round((arch.first_time-appl.first_time)*1440) "DiffMins" from (select thread# ,sequence#,first_time from v$archived_log where (thread#,first_time ) in (select thread#,max(first_time) from v$archived_log group by thread#)) arch, (select thread# ,sequence#,first_time from v$log_history where (thread#,first_time ) in (select thread#,max(first_time) from v$log_history group by thread#)) appl where arch.thread# = appl.thread# order by 1; Regards, Sanjeev.
